IP查询
查询
你查询的IP:[116.196.80.196] 地理位置:中国–北京–北京京东云
最新查询
58.16.145.143
119.4.173.102
59.151.195.150
125.208.181.35
221.122.194.64
124.200.248.65
118.84.137.102
117.75.184.156
118.84.198.118
116.196.80.196
60.160.40.252
203.175.192.239
116.69.227.235
123.56.116.211
116.242.15.225
202.95.252.121
58.100.154.38
119.60.47.66
202.10.64.69
123.244.32.234
202.91.176.132
210.14.64.98
125.214.96.4
121.52.208.100
221.12.122.72
210.22.236.188
202.127.208.18
203.119.32.148
202.168.160.70
202.4.252.88
122.192.228.135